Default SCFM vs. CFM, also air flow/pressure across a regulator

In article , Roger Head says...

Hmmm, well.... CFM is volume/min, and per-se is not related to mass
flow. SCFM, on the other hand, indirectly specifies a mass flow because
the air is at STP.


Other gasses are also specified in SCFM.
It doesn't have to be air. You would have different
mass flows for one scfm of, say, hydrogen vs the
same scfm of xenon.
